Dear All,
Actually I built a mode multiplexing system with two mode each one with 8-DPSK.
But the system is working well for the fundamental mode but it provide closed eye diagram for the LP02 carrying mode.
I don’t know the source of the problem but i think that the power of LP02 mode is small.
The main 8-DPSK is downloaded from Optiwave download area.
Can anyone help me to improve LP02 BER?
Can i use EDFA black box for the LP02 amplification before transmission or it works only for LP02? (i tested it,it is not working with me).
In the last row,i mean “………..or it works only for LP01?”
You should be able to use the EDFA to amplify the modes. I just tried it out and it is working for me. LP 01 and LP 02.
The power does seem a lot lower for the LP02 mode. Have you tried using the built-in PSK coders and modulators? The simulation will probably run much faster and be more readable. Look at the example files in “OptiSystem 12 Samples/Advanced modulation systems/PSK systems”
